Guylaine Tremblay (born October 9, 1960) is a Canadian actress from Québec. She is most noted for her role of Caro Paré in the sitcom La Petite vie and her performance in the film Contre toute espérance, for which she won the Prix Jutra for Best Actress at the 10th Jutra Awards in 2008.
